Transaction 7f63feec521ddad36b11736e069c3397fb8a46c21bfafe27b05824bfc8c9a994
1 Input
1 Output
-
7f63feec521ddad36b11736e069c3397fb8a46c21bfafe27b05824bfc8c9a994:0
- value
- 2966826
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a653665a08596571a4147e4f7b52bda64c4e0b5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DcmVqhJ2qeyCsxjna8g5NNSfde2P62WjU